MEDIAZOIC SUPPORTS HIGHER TARIFF FOR ONLINE PLAYS
Greg Nisbet, founder & CEO of Toronto-based digital music company Mediazoic, argues in favour of a rewrite of the financially threadbare Tariff 8, opining that "fairness" to creators is good for business, his included. The following is taken from a longer op-Ed that Nisbet wrote for the Music Canada website.
... Streaming companies do need an environment in which to make a profit. But rather than push for lower rates, my company Mediazoic) chose to innovate the business model. Basically, we believe the success of each project we undertake is based on three parties – us for providing the platform, the rights holders of the music played on our system, and our station hosts (clients) for getting it out there. As such, when planning and implementing a project, we always strive for a fair and transparent split of the revenue between the parties. This isn’t just because we’re nice and we love music – we believe that in the music business of the future, the most successful companies will be the most fair and transparent.
